Ayutthaya is around 80km from Bangkok, Thailand. I went for a guided tour to Ayutthaya. The place looks awesome with ruins dating to the 14th century and some wonderful palaces which are still used by the royal family.
This was shot at Wat Yai Chaimonkorn, Ayutthaya. I had seen similar photographs for sale at Bangkok. Applied selective colouring to get a similar effect.
